Unlocking Real-Time Transcription with Qwen3-ASR-0.6B

The Qwen3-ASR-0.6B model is a cutting-edge speech recognition system designed for real-time transcription across multiple languages. Its compact architecture enables accurate and efficient performance, making it an ideal choice for various applications. With its language-agnostic encoder, the model can handle less common languages with ease, expanding its usability. This innovative design also leverages efficient attention mechanisms to achieve low inference latency, ensuring seamless real-time capabilities.
